Nearest airports to city Exeter, country United Kingdom are listed below. These are significant airports near to the city of Exeter and other airports nearest to Exeter.
Nearest airport to Exeter is Plymouth City Airport distance - (60 km / 37.5 miles)
Following are the nearest airports to Exeter and Exeter International Airport. Distance between the two airports are given in kilometer as well as in miles below.
Airport Name | Distance | Lat | Long | ICAOCode | IATACode |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Plymouth City Airport | 60 km /37.5 miles | 50.42279816 | -4.105830193 | EGHD | PLH |
RNAS Yeovilton | 63 km /39.375 miles | 51.00939941 | -2.638819933 | EGDY | YEO |
Cardiff International Airport | 74 km /46.25 miles | 51.39670181 | -3.343329906 | EGFF | CWL |
MOD St. Athan | 75 km /46.875 miles | 51.40480042 | -3.435750008 | EGDX | DGX |
Bristol International Airport | 87 km /54.375 miles | 51.38270187 | -2.719089985 | EGGD | BRS |
